Neumann MCM 114 Set Double Bass – Miniature Clip Mic System With MC 3

The Neumann MCM 114 Set Double Bass is a premium miniature condenser microphone system designed specifically for double bass and similar large string instruments. It combines the KK 14 cardioid capsule, SH 150 gooseneck, and the MC 3 rib clip, delivering rich, natural low-frequency response with exceptional detail, isolation, and stability.

Engineered as part of the Neumann Miniature Clip Mic (MCM) modular system, this set brings Neumann’s world-class studio sound to stage performance, broadcast, and recording. The MC 3 clip mounts securely to the bass rib without damaging the instrument’s finish and allows precise positioning of the microphone.

Key Features

  • Studio-grade KK 14 true condenser capsule with 20 Hz – 20 kHz frequency response

  • Designed for double bass, with full-bodied tone and accurate transient capture

  • Handles SPL levels up to 152 dB, ideal for both arco and pizzicato playing styles

  • MC 3 rib clip attaches securely to the instrument without scratches or vibration transfer

  • SH 150 flexible gooseneck enables precise placement near the f-hole or bridge area

  • Modular system—capsule, cable, gooseneck, and clip are all interchangeable

  • Compatible with Neumann MCM 100 output stage and most wireless transmitters

  • Ultra-low self-noise (23 dB A) and high sensitivity (3.6 mV/Pa) for pristine clarity

Technical Specifications

Microphone Type: True condenser
Polar Pattern: Cardioid
Frequency Response: 20 Hz – 20 kHz
Sensitivity: 3.6 mV/Pa
Equivalent Noise Level: 23 dB (A)
Maximum SPL (THD < 0.5 %): 152 dB
Rated Impedance: 50 Ω
Connector Type: 3.5 mm locking / mini XLR / LEMO (depending on cable)
Power Supply: Wireless bodypack or Neumann MCM 100 output stage
Operating Temperature: 0 °C – 40 °C
